A cold milling machine is a specialized piece of equipment designed to remove asphalt and concrete surfaces from roadways, parking lots, and airport runways with precision and efficiency. The primary functions include grinding, pulverizing, and collecting old pavement materials for recycling purposes, making it an environmentally responsible solution for infrastructure maintenance. Modern cold milling machines feature advanced technological capabilities that set them apart in the industry. These machines utilize high-speed rotating drums equipped with carbide teeth that break down hardened surfaces effectively. The cold milling machine price varies based on cutting depth capacity, drum width, and engine power specifications. Advanced models incorporate automatic depth control systems, dust suppression technology, and real-time monitoring sensors that enhance operational precision. Applications for cold milling machines span multiple sectors, including municipal road maintenance, highway rehabilitation, parking lot renovation, and airport runway restoration. Construction companies and municipalities rely on cold milling machine price assessments to budget capital expenditure appropriately. The equipment's versatility makes it invaluable for removing surface imperfections, correcting crown issues, and preparing surfaces for new asphalt placement. Superior Precision and Depth Control Technology

Superior Precision and Depth Control Technology

Advanced cold milling machine price options incorporate automated depth control systems that ensure consistent surface removal across entire project areas. This precision technology eliminates manual adjustments, allowing single operators to maintain exact specifications throughout extended work sessions. The sophisticated sensor systems monitor cutting depth in real-time, compensating automatically for surface variations and equipment wear. Superior precision directly impacts project quality, ensuring surfaces meet specification requirements without rework or costly corrections. When evaluating cold milling machine price, the inclusion of advanced depth control justifies higher investment through reduced material waste and improved efficiency. Modern machines achieve accuracy within fractions of inches, critical for ensuring proper drainage and structural integrity. Cost Efficiency and Material Recycling Benefits

Cost Efficiency and Material Recycling Benefits

Cold milling machine price investments deliver substantial returns through integrated material recycling capabilities that reduce transportation and disposal expenses. On-site recycling systems collect removed asphalt and concrete, immediately preparing materials for reuse in new pavement applications or aggregates. This functionality eliminates expensive trucking costs associated with hauling materials to distant processing facilities or landfills. Contractors investing in cold milling machine price solutions experience reduced environmental compliance costs and improved sustainability credentials. Recycled materials achieve cost savings of fifteen to twenty percent compared to virgin aggregates, directly improving project economics.
